11 Lou Lopez-Senechal

  • Position Forward
  • Height 6-1
  • Class Senior
  • Highschool NABA Academy
  • Hometown Grenoble, France

Biography

2021-22: MAAC Player of the Year…All-Met First Team…ECAC First Team…MAAC Tournament Most Valuable Player…MAAC All-Tournament Team…All-MAAC First Team…MAAC All-Academic Team…MAAC Player of the Week (11/29; 1/3; 1/10)…Became just the second Stag in program history to eclipse 600-points in a season as she led the MAAC with 604 points and finished in the top-25 in the country with a 19.6 scoring average…Netted 20 or more points in 16-straight games including a program-record tying nine-straight games (12/20 – 1/27)…Poured in a career-high 30-points in back-to-back games at Manhattan (2/26) and Rider (3/3)…Named the MAAC Tournament’s MVP by averaging 18.7 points in the tournament highlighted by a 24-point performance in the MAAC Championship (3/12)…Had the game-winning steal and fast break layup in the closing seconds of her Senior Day win against Rider (3/3)…Led the MAAC with a .409 3-point shooting percentage, the fifth best in program history…Finished in the top-5 in the MAAC in: field goal percentage (.449), free throw percentage (.800), and 3-pointers per game (1.7)…Led the team in scoring 21 times including racking up 17 points in 30 minutes in the NCAA Tournament at Texas (3/18).

2020-21: All-MAAC First Team…All-Met First Team…MAAC Player of the Week (12/7, 1/4)…MAAC All-Academic Team…Led the team and finished second in the MAAC with 16.9 points per game…Also finished second in the conference in 3-point percentage (.407) and fourth in field goal percentage (.424)…Reached 20 points in seven games including a career-high 27 at Rider (1/2)…Shot 6-for-8 from behind the arc against Hofstra, the fourth best single game shooting percentage in program history (12/6)…Reached double figures in 15 of 16 starts…Had the game-winning shot in the final minute against Marist (1/16).

2019-20: All-MAAC First Team…MAAC All-Academic Team…Finished fifth in the MAAC with a team-high 15.5 points per game…Scored in double figures in 18 of 20 MAAC contests, reaching 20 points in six different of those…Netted a career-high 27 points in the near upset at St. John’s (12/20) and the regular season finale against Niagara (3/7)…Hit a personal best six 3-points in 10 attempts against Niagara…Had back-to-back 20 point games in the Western New York series, shooting 5-for-6 from behind the arc at Niagara (2/6)…Hit the game-winning shot in the final seconds at LIU (11/13)…Recorded three double-doubles on the year including each of the final two contests, with 27 points and 11 rebounds in the regular season finale and 19 points with 10 boards in the MAAC Quarterfinal (3/12)…Averaged 17.8 points in the final seven games…Ranked third in the league in free throw percentage (.856), sixth in 3-pointers per game (1.9), and seventh in 3-point percentage (.392).

2018-19: MAAC Rookie of the Year…All-MAAC Rookie Team…4X MAAC Rookie of the Week (1/7, 2/11, 2/18, 3/4)…Named the program’s first MAAC Rookie of the Year since Candice Lindsay in 2004…Led the conference with four MAAC Rookie of the Week awards…Despite missing the first nine games of the season, she led the Stags with 11.8 points per game…Also averaged 4.7 rebounds and 1.8 assists…Had four of the team’s six 20-point outputs, reaching 21 points against UIC (12/21) and Siena (2/14)…Had 14 double-digit scoring performances…Recorded her first career double-double with 12 points and 10 rebounds at Saint Peter’s, while also dishing out a personal-best six assists (2/22)…Finished second in the MAAC with a .857 free throw percentage...Also led the team with 13 drawn charges.

BEFORE FAIRFIELD: Lou Lopez Senechal's journey to Fairfield went through Ireland as the guard and forward combo player suited up for the North Atlantic Basketball Academy. Lopez Senechal brings a European style to the team as she is also a French basketball player. Lopez can play in the post, showing her versatility with a 32-point 10 rebound effort in December.

PERSONAL: Parents are Sophie Senechal and Timothy Presto...Major is marketing.
